Secret Craft: The Journalism of Edward FarrerUniversity of Toronto Press, 1992 - Počet stran: 334 The biography of an original and unconventional Canadian journalist who became editor of the Toronto Mail in 1885 and was immersed in the volatile issue of annexation to the US in 1891.
